North American Sustainable Refrigeration Council

  • Company Profile
  • Articles

Company Profile

North American Sustainable Refrigeration Council
35 Miller Ave., No. 1019
Mill Valley, CA 94941
United States
https://nasrc.org
info@nasrc.org

Contact

Morgan Smith, Sr. Dir.
info@nasrc.org
An action-oriented environmental nonprofit working with the grocery refrigeration industry to eliminate barriers to natural refrigerants and enable their widespread adoption across U.S. grocery stores.
